About Hawasa

Hawasa is a rural settlement in Hayaghat, Darbhanga, Bihar. It has a population of 2,783 in about 608 households (avg size: 4.58). Approximate literacy: 34.28%.

Population of Hawasa

Population (Total)2,783
Male1,470
Female1,313
Children (0–6 years)564
Households608
Literate persons954
Illiterate persons1,829
Total workers853
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)893
Literacy (approx.)34.28%
SC population1,928
ST population0
